Sept 29 NSO Area Volleyball Recap

Sept 30

Wes Vork-NSO


Tuesday night brought some great volleyball action to the Northland. In what was by far the biggest game of the night, the Barnum Bombers beat Esko in four games to put themselves at the top of the Polar League standings and extend their winning streak to 12 games. There were other NSO area games on the menu as well.

Of course, the big match up was the Barnum at Esko game which saw the Bombers win 19-25, 26-24, 25-22 and 25-18. Barnum was led by the efforts of Katrina and Jessica Newman. Katrina ended the night with 21 kills and 10 digs. Jessica meanwhile, totaled 34 set assists while running the offense. Kayla Handevidt had a big night for the Eskomos with 21 kills, 4 ace serves and 3 blocks.

The Cloquet Lumberjacks picked up a 3-1 win over Hinckley-Finlayson as Katie Konietzko led the way with 6 kills, 3 ace serves and 4 blocks. Cloquet won by scores of 25-6, 25-16, 20-25, and 25-18.

AlBrook parlayed 14 kills from Abby Otis into a 3-0 win over Wrenshall by scores of 25-22, 25-13, and 25-9. Kortney Karppinen added 12 kills and Chelsea Hendrickson finished with 23 set assists.

In other volleyball news, the Carlton Bulldogs needed five games to beat the pesky Cromwell Cards. Carlton won the fifth and deciding game with a score of 15-11. Taylor Carpenter had 23 kills for the Bulldogs and Ashley Collman recorded 6 kills and 14 digs for the Cards. Scores from the match were 23-25, 21-25, 25-19, 26-16 and 15-11.

Finally, the Moose Lake-Willow River Rebels struggled on Tuesday as they dropped a 3-0 decision to the always tough Hermantown Hawks.
